日期:2014-05-17  浏览次数:20804 次

xml 读值
C# code



<?xml version="1.0"?>
-<ArrayOfanyType x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.microsoft.com/2003/10/Serialization/Arrays"><anyType xmlns:a="http://www.w3.org/2001/XMLSchema" i:type="a:string">AAAA </anyType><anyType xmlns:a="http://www.w3.org/2001/XMLSchema" i:type="a:string">BBB </anyType><anyType xmlns:a="http://www.w3.org/2001/XMLSchema" i:type="a:string">CCC </anyType></ArrayOfanyType>



怎样读取 值????

------解决方案--------------------
http://topic.csdn.net/u/20110222/17/a74697cc-d2bf-4a48-b11f-aa4bff37f135.html
------解决方案--------------------
<?xml version="1.0"?>
-<ArrayOfanyType x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
这个【-】是什么东西。

C# code


 System.Xml.XmlDocument xdoc = new System.Xml.XmlDocument();
            xdoc.Load(@"c:\test.xml");

            List<string> result = new List<string>();
            foreach (XmlNode node in xdoc.ChildNodes[1].ChildNodes)
            {
                result.Add(node.InnerText);
            }